Lesotho arrive late for World Cup qualifier against Ghana

Lesotho will arrive in Kumasi on Friday morning less than 12 hours before playing Ghana in a 2014 FIFA World Cup qualifier.

The Southern African country failed to secure the necessary travelling documents in time and issues of a bonus row affected their travelling plans.

The Crocodiles touched down in Accra on Thursday night from South Africa.

They will connect a 30-minute flight to Kumasi at 08: 000 before kick-off at 5:00pm local time.

Lesotho are likely to suffer from jet lag and would not have the benefit of training at the Baba Yara Stadium before the match.

Leslie Notsi’s side were beaten 3-0 by Ghana in Sekondi in October 2008 during the 2010 World Cup qualifiers.
